Pewnie nie jeden/a z was przy budowanie strony używa swoich ulubionych komponentów, modułów czy też dodatków (pluginów). Raz za razem ściągamy lub instalujemy pojedynczo przez web installer lub lokalnie. A cobyście powiedzieli aby stworzyć paczkę instalacyjną z naszymi wybranymi komponentami i zainstalować wszystko za jednym razem! Ciekawi ? to zapraszam dalej dowiecie się jak to uczyć w prosty sposób krok po kroku.

A więc na początek trzeba ściągnąć na dysk lokalny nasze ulubione komponenty, dodatki czy też moduły, ten zabieg jest kluczowy ponieważ będą nam one potrzebne do stworzenia paczki instalacyjnej. Paczka instalacyjna będzie stworzona w ten sposób że wszystko się zainstaluje od razu bez konieczności mozolnego powtarzania czynności. Stworzenie takiej multi instalacyjnej paczki nie wymaga znajomości programowania, możesz sobie już teraz wyobrazić o ile skróci to czas przygotowania strony dla siebie bądź klienta.

Przykładowo chcemy zainstalować te przykładowe komponenty, moduły oraz dodatki

  1. JCE Editor
  2. JCH_Optimze
  3. SIGE 
  4. SIGE Button
  5. RS FIREWALL

Normalnie wyglądałoby to tak część jest darmowa cześć jest płatna więc cześć można ściągnąć przez web installer a część ręcznie. Multi instalacyjną paczkę stworzymy raz, a wykorzystać będziecie mogli cały czas. Ponieważ aktualizacja jej będzie wymagała tylko podmiany za aktualizowanego rozszerzania i przepakowania głównego zipa. 

Krok 1

Ściągamy potrzebne nam komponenty, moduły i dodatki na dysk lokalny.

Krok 2

Tworzymy pusty folder o nazwie plg_massinstall

Krok 3

Kopiujemy wszystkie nasze komponenty i dodatki do stworzonego folderu.

Krok 4

Tworzymy pusty plik .xml o takiej samej nazwie czyli plg_massinstall.xml

Krok 5

Otwieramy plik plg_massinstall.xml i dodajemy odpowiednie wpisy

multi pack

Oczywiście jest to przykład! Używamy swoich danych

Omówienie:

  • xml - nagłówek
  • extension version - od jakiej wersji ma Joomla pozwalać instalować oraz metoda instalacji 
  • name - Moja Masowa Instalacja - nazwa
  • creationdate - data utworzenia
  • packagename - nazwa paczki
  • author  - autor
  • version - wersja paczki
  • url - adres strony opcjonalny
  • packager - Kto stworzył paczkę
  • description - opis narzędzia

Krok 6

Wskazujemy w pliku gdzie pliki się znajdują i jaką maja grupę.

multi pack 2

Więcej na temat typów i grup:

https://docs.joomla.org/Package

Krok 7

Pakujemy wszystko do .zip i nadajemy nazwę przykładową plg_massinstall 

Krok 8

Instalujemy na stronie, aby sprawdzić czy wszystko przebiegło pomyśle.

 

Mała uwaga trzeba zwrócić uwagę że ten sposób działa na instalacje utworzone zgodnie z standardem Joomla, ponieważ są inne instalatory oskryptowane i takie mogą nam sprawić problemy podczas instalacji multipaczki.

POBIERZ